Key Concepts +and Terms
+ +
Sensor
+

A sensor is a hardware measuring device connected to the Symbian +device, which measures a physical quantity in its immediate vicinity and converts +that quantity into small sets of numeric digital values.

+
+ +
Sensor Subsystem (SSY)
+

Sensor Subsystems are plug-ins that connect the sensor hardware with +the sensor server.

+
+
+
Architecture + +Sensor Services Architecture + +

The Sensor Services collection consists of the following components:

    +
  • Sensor Framework, which provides sensor server and plug-in interfaces +for adding any new sensor plug-in as required. The framework also provides +sensor channel APIs for creating a medium (sensor channel) of exchange between +the client applications and the sensor hardware. The sensor plug-ins retrieve +data from sensor hardware (through sensor channels) and enable the client +applications to use the data for specific requirements.

  • +
  • Data Compensator, which uses data provided by the sensor plug-ins +to correct the sensor axis data based on the current orientation of the Symbian +device. This data can be used by the client applications to display the pages +in portrait or landscape views.
